溫馨提示×

如何使用reload命令刷新MySQL緩存

小樊
98
2024-08-09 15:15:33
欄目: 云計(jì)算

在 MySQL 中,可以使用 FLUSH PRIVILEGES; 命令來刷新權(quán)限緩存,該命令會(huì)重新加載權(quán)限表并使新的權(quán)限設(shè)置立即生效。

另外,如果需要刷新其他緩存,可以使用 FLUSH TABLES; 命令來刷新表緩存,FLUSH QUERY CACHE; 命令來刷新查詢緩存,FLUSH STATUS; 命令來刷新服務(wù)器狀態(tài)信息等。

如果需要重新加載整個(gè)數(shù)據(jù)庫,可以使用 FLUSH TABLES WITH READ LOCK; 來將所有表置為只讀狀態(tài),并且可以使用 UNLOCK TABLES; 來釋放表的鎖定狀態(tài)。

請注意,在執(zhí)行這些命令時(shí)要謹(jǐn)慎,確保不會(huì)對數(shù)據(jù)庫產(chǎn)生意外影響。

0